What is a Joint Venture Development Agreement?
The Joint Venture Development Agreement is a crucial document used when two or more parties wish to collaborate on development projects in the United Arab Emirates. This agreement type is particularly relevant in the UAE market where foreign investors often partner with local entities to comply with ownership requirements and leverage local expertise. The document addresses key aspects required under UAE Federal Commercial Companies Law and relevant emirate-specific regulations, including corporate structure, capital contributions, profit sharing, and management control. It is especially important for large-scale development projects where parties need to clearly define their roles, responsibilities, and risk allocation while ensuring compliance with local laws regarding foreign investment, property development, and company formation.

When do you need this document?
You need this agreement when partnering with other entities for property development, infrastructure projects, or mixed-use developments in the UAE. This is particularly crucial when foreign investors collaborate with local UAE partners to meet ownership requirements under Federal Law No. 19 of 2018. The document is essential for large-scale projects involving master developers, government entities, and international investment firms. You'll also require this agreement when establishing joint ventures for free zone developments, tourism projects, or industrial developments where multiple parties bring complementary expertise and resources.
Key legal considerations
Your agreement must address ownership structures that comply with UAE foreign investment restrictions, particularly the requirement for UAE national ownership in certain sectors. Capital contribution arrangements need clear documentation, including cash contributions, land transfers, and in-kind contributions such as permits or expertise. Profit and loss sharing mechanisms must align with each party's contributions and risk exposure. Management control provisions should establish decision-making processes, board composition, and operational responsibilities. Exit strategies require careful structuring to address scenarios such as project completion, default, or voluntary withdrawal. Environmental compliance clauses must reference UAE Environmental Law requirements and emirate-specific environmental regulations.
Legal requirements in United Arab Emirates
Your joint venture must comply with UAE Federal Commercial Companies Law (Federal Law No. 2 of 2015) regarding company formation and governance structures. Foreign ownership limitations under Federal Law No. 19 of 2018 may require specific ownership percentages and local partner involvement. Each emirate has distinct real estate laws governing property development, land registration, and construction permits that your agreement must address. Environmental impact assessments and compliance with Federal Law No. 24 of 1999 may be mandatory depending on project scope. The agreement must specify the governing UAE court jurisdiction and applicable emirate laws. Corporate registration requirements, including trade license applications and regulatory approvals, must be clearly allocated between parties. Tax obligations under UAE corporate tax laws and potential double taxation treaties require specific consideration in profit-sharing arrangements.
GOVERNING LAW
Applicable law
This Joint Venture Development Agreement is drafted to comply with United Arab Emirates law. Key legislation includes:
UAE Civil Code (Federal Law No. 5 of 1985): Fundamental law governing contractual relationships, obligations, and general principles of contract formation
UAE Foreign Direct Investment Law (Federal Law No. 19 of 2018): Regulates foreign investment and ownership in UAE companies, including permitted activities and ownership restrictions
Real Estate Laws (varies by Emirate): Local emirate-specific laws governing property development, ownership, and registration requirements
UAE Environmental Law (Federal Law No. 24 of 1999): Regulations concerning environmental protection and impact assessment for development projects
UAE Labor Law (Federal Law No. 8 of 1980): Governs employment relationships and workforce requirements for the joint venture
UAE Competition Law (Federal Law No. 4 of 2012): Regulates anti-competitive practices and ensures fair market competition
UAE Building Codes and Construction Regulations: Technical requirements and standards for construction and development projects
UAE Tax Laws and VAT Regulations: Fiscal obligations and tax compliance requirements for the joint venture
UAE Anti-Money Laundering Laws: Compliance requirements for financial transactions and corporate structures
